Ornamental plaster can add a stunning design element to almost any space, but the decoration requires care to keep it looking beautiful for as long as possible. Without proper preservation techniques, plaster can crack, bulge, or deteriorate. Call in a restoration professional if you notice any such wear. In the meantime, here are some tips to help keep your plaster in fantastic shape.

How to Care for Ornamental Plaster

1. Address Leaks

Plaster should be kept dry at all times. Direct contact with water can quickly lead to severe damage. Because the material is somewhat water soluble, moisture can degrade it to the point of cracking. Regularly inspect for leaks in and around the area and have them fixed as soon as possible to avoid damage.

2. Regulate Humidityornamental plaster

Ornamental plaster with wooden armatures (the framework underneath that holds its form) will warp when exposed to high levels of humidity. This movement can crack the surface of the plaster. The dampness also weakens the material and can make it vulnerable to structural damage from the slightest bump.

3. Use the Right Cleaning Techniques

Clean ornamental plaster regularly to maintain its appearance, but do so carefully to avoid unnecessary damage. Use a soft cloth or brush to dust the surface and avoid using liquid. A slightly damp cloth can be used to wipe away small, recent stains, but a professional should address deeper dirt or grime. These issues require specialized cleaning products and methods to preserve the plaster’s integrity.
